Lines Matching refs:sdtemp_softc

48 struct sdtemp_softc {  struct
68 CFATTACH_DECL_NEW(sdtemp, sizeof(struct sdtemp_softc), argument
77 static int sdtemp_read_8(struct sdtemp_softc *, uint8_t, uint8_t *);
78 static int sdtemp_write_8(struct sdtemp_softc *, uint8_t, uint8_t);
80 static int sdtemp_read_16(struct sdtemp_softc *, uint8_t, uint16_t *);
81 static int sdtemp_write_16(struct sdtemp_softc *, uint8_t, uint16_t);
82 static uint32_t sdtemp_decode_temp(struct sdtemp_softc *, uint16_t);
86 static void sdtemp_config_mcp(struct sdtemp_softc *);
87 static void sdtemp_config_idt(struct sdtemp_softc *);
93 void (*sdtemp_config)(struct sdtemp_softc *);
208 struct sdtemp_softc sc; in sdtemp_match()
254 struct sdtemp_softc *sc = device_private(self); in sdtemp_attach()
414 struct sdtemp_softc *sc = device_private(self); in sdtemp_detach()
431 struct sdtemp_softc *sc = sme->sme_cookie; in sdtemp_get_limits()
461 struct sdtemp_softc *sc = sme->sme_cookie; in sdtemp_set_limits()
504 sdtemp_read_8(struct sdtemp_softc *sc, uint8_t reg, uint8_t *valp) in sdtemp_read_8()
515 sdtemp_write_8(struct sdtemp_softc *sc, uint8_t reg, uint8_t val) in sdtemp_write_8()
524 sdtemp_read_16(struct sdtemp_softc *sc, uint8_t reg, uint16_t *valp) in sdtemp_read_16()
539 sdtemp_write_16(struct sdtemp_softc *sc, uint8_t reg, uint16_t val) in sdtemp_write_16()
549 sdtemp_decode_temp(struct sdtemp_softc *sc, uint16_t temp) in sdtemp_decode_temp()
577 struct sdtemp_softc *sc = sme->sme_cookie; in sdtemp_refresh()
624 struct sdtemp_softc *sc = device_private(dev); in sdtemp_pmf_suspend()
644 struct sdtemp_softc *sc = device_private(dev); in sdtemp_pmf_resume()
664 sdtemp_config_mcp(struct sdtemp_softc *sc) in sdtemp_config_mcp()
700 sdtemp_config_idt(struct sdtemp_softc *sc) in sdtemp_config_idt()